Campsites near pubs

Camping is all about great walks and enjoying the outdoors to the fullest - but there's little that can finish off a day of working up a good appetite than a proper pub with top ales and the right food. So pull up a stool and join in with the locals, it's not like you've got far to walk when they close! Conveniently in staggering distance, these pubs will add a warm and cosy place to eat, drink and banter with new friends to your break.
